MsCommerce PowerShell -moduulin AllowSelfServicePurchase-toiminnon käyttäminen
MSCommerce PowerShell -moduuli on nyt käytettävissä PowerShell-valikoimassa. Moduuli sisältää AllowSelfServicePurchase-parametriarvonPolicyID, jonka avulla voit hallita, voivatko organisaatiosi käyttäjät tehdä Microsoftin itsepalveluostoja tai valita kolmannen osapuolen tarjouksia.
MSCommerce PowerShell -moduulin avulla voit tehdä seuraavaa:
- Näytä AllowSelfServicePurchase-parametriarvon oletustila – onko se käytössä, poistettu käytöstä vai salliiko kokeiluversiot ilman maksutapaa
- Tarkastele luetteloa soveltuvista tuotteista ja onko omatoiminen ostaminen käytössä, poistettu käytöstä vai salliiko kokeiluversiot ilman maksutapaa
- Näyttää tietyn tuotteen nykyisen asetuksen tai muokkaa sitä, jos haluat joko ottaa sen käyttöön tai poistaa sen käytöstä
- Näytä kokeilujen asetus tai muokkaa sitä ilman maksutapoja
Vaatimukset
Jos haluat käyttää MSCommerce PowerShell -moduulia, tarvitset seuraavat asiat:
- Windows 10 tai uudempi käyttöjärjestelmä.
- PowerShell 5 tai sitä uudempi. Tällä hetkellä PowerShell 6.x/7.x ei ole tuettu tässä moduulissa.
- Vuokraajasi yleinen tai laskutuksen järjestelmänvalvojan rooli MSCommerce-tuotekäytäntöjen muuttamiseksi.
- Vuokraajan yleinen lukijarooli MSCommerce-tuotekäytäntöjen vain luku -luettelon näkemiseksi.
MSCommerce PowerShell -moduulin asentaminen
Asenna MSCommerce PowerShell -moduuli Windows 10 laitteeseesi kerran ja tuo se sitten jokaiseen aloittamaasi PowerShell-istuntoon. Lataa MSCommerce PowerShell -moduuli PowerShell-valikoimasta.
Asenna MSCommerce PowerShell -moduuli PowerShellGet:n kanssa suorittamalla seuraava komento:
Install-Module -Name MSCommerce
MSCommercen tuominen PowerShell-istuntoon
Kun olet asentanut moduulin Windows 10 laitteeseesi, tuot sen sitten jokaiseen aloittamaasi PowerShell-istuntoon. Voit tuoda sen PowerShell-istuntoon suorittamalla seuraavan komennon:
Import-Module -Name MSCommerce
Muodosta yhteys MSCommerceen tunnistetiedoillasi
Jos haluat muodostaa yhteyden PowerShell-moduuliin tunnistetiedoillasi, suorita seuraava komento.
Connect-MSCommerce
Tämä komento yhdistää nykyisen PowerShell-istunnon Microsoft Entra vuokraajaan. Komento pyytää käyttäjätunnusta ja salasanaa vuokraajalle, johon haluat muodostaa yhteyden. Jos tunnistetiedoillasi on käytössä monimenetelmäinen todentaminen, kirjaudu sisään vuorovaikutteisen vaihtoehdon avulla.
Näytä AllowSelfServicePurchase-toiminnon tiedot
Jos haluat tarkastella AllowSelfServicePurchase-parametriarvon kuvausta ja oletustilaa organisaatiosi perusteella, suorita seuraava komento:
Get-MSCommercePolicy -PolicyId AllowSelfServicePurchase
Näytä omatoimisen oston tuotteiden luettelo ja niiden tila
Jos haluat tarkastella luetteloa kaikista saatavilla olevista itsepalveluostotuotteista ja niiden tilaa, suorita seuraava komento:
Get-MSCommerceProductPolicies -PolicyId AllowSelfServicePurchase
Seuraavassa taulukossa on lueteltu saatavilla olevat tuotteet ja niiden ProductId-tunnus. Se ilmaisee myös, millä tuotteilla on käytettävissään kokeiluversio, eivätkä ne edellytä maksutapaa. Jos sovellettavissa, kaikki muut kokeiluversiot edellyttävät maksutapaa. Jos tuotteen kokeiluversio on käytössä ilman maksutapaa, voit ottaa kokeiluversion käyttöön ja pitää tuotteen ostomahdollisena. Esimerkkikomennot ovat kohdassa AllowSelfServicePurchase-tilan tarkasteleminen tai määrittäminen.
Tuote | Productid | Onko kokeiluversio ilman maksutapaa käytössä? |
---|---|---|
Clipchamp Premium | CFQ7TTC0N8SS | Ei |
Power Apps käyttäjää kohti* | CFQ7TTC0LH2H | Ei |
Käyttäjäkohtainen Power Automate* | CFQ7TTC0LH3L | Ei |
Power Automaten RPA* | CFQ7TTC0LSGZ | Ei |
Power BI Premium (erillinen)* | CFQ7TTC0H6RP | Ei |
Power BI Pro* | CFQ7TTC0H9MP | Ei |
Project (palvelupaketti 1)* | CFQ7TTC0HDB1 | Kyllä |
Project (palvelupaketti 3)* | CFQ7TTC0HDB0 | Ei |
Teams Exploratory | CFQ7TTC0J1FV | Kyllä |
Teams Premium Esittelyn hinnoittelu | CFQ7TTC0RM8K | Kyllä |
Visio (palvelupaketti 1)* | CFQ7TTC0HD33 | Kyllä |
Visio (palvelupaketti 2)* | CFQ7TTC0HD32 | Ei |
Viva Goals (vain omatoimisen kokeiluversiot) | CFQ7TTC0PW0V | Kyllä |
Windows 365 Enterprise | CFQ7TTC0HHS9 | Ei |
Windows 365 Business | CFQ7TTC0J203 | Ei |
Windows 365 Business ja Windows Hybrid Benefit | CFQ7TTC0HX99 | Ei |
Microsoft 365 F3 | CFQ7TTC0LH05 | Ei |
Microsoft Purview Discovery | CFQ7TTC0N8SL | Kyllä |
*Nämä tunnukset ovat muuttuneet. Jos olet aiemmin estänyt tuotteiden käytön vanhoilla tunnuksilla, uudet tunnukset estävät ne automaattisesti. Mitään muuta työtä ei tarvita.
Näytä omatoimisen oston "kolmannen osapuolen tarjoustyypit" ja niiden tila
Jos haluat tarkastella luetteloa kaikista saatavilla olevista kolmansien osapuolten itsepalveluostojen tarjoustyypeistä ja niiden tilasta, suorita seuraava komento:
Get-MSCommerceProductPolicies -PolicyId AllowSelfServicePurchase -Scope OfferType
Seuraavassa taulukossa on lueteltu käytettävissä olevat kolmannen osapuolen tarjoustyypit. Nämä tarjoustyypit voidaan ottaa käyttöön tai poistaa käytöstä omatoimista ostoa varten.
Tarjouksen tyyppi | Tunnus |
---|---|
Software as a Service | Saas |
Power BI :n visualisoinnit | POWERBIVISUALS |
Dynamics 365 Dataverse-sovellukset | DYNAMICSCE |
Dynamics 365 Business Central | DYNAMICSBC |
Näytä AllowSelfServicePurchase-tila tai määritä sen tila
Voit määrittää AllowSelfServicePurchase-kohteenArvo-parametrin sallimaan tai estämään käyttäjiä tekemästä itsepalveluostoja. Voit myös käyttää OnlyTrialsWithoutPaymentMethod-arvoa , jos haluat, että käyttäjät voivat kokeilla tuotteita, joissa ei ole maksuvelvollisia kokeiluversioita. Katso yllä olevasta tuoteluettelosta, missä tuotteissa nämä kokeiluversiot ovat käytössä. Käyttäjät voivat ostaa tuotteen vasta kokeilujakson päätyttyä, jos AllowSelfServicePurchase on käytössä.
Huomautus
AllowSelfServicePurchase- tai OnlyTrialsWithoutPaymentMethod-arvon muuttaminen vaikuttaa vain määritetyn tuotteen kokeiluversioihin tai ostoihin tästä eteenpäin. Tämä ei vaikuta määritetyn tuotteen aiempiin kokeiluversioihin tai ostoihin.
Seuraavassa taulukossa kuvataan Arvo-parametrin asetukset.
Asetus | Vaikutus |
---|---|
Käytössä | Käyttäjät voivat tehdä itsepalveluostoja ja hankkia kokeiluversioita tuotteelle. |
OnlyTrialsWithoutPaymentMethod | Käyttäjät eivät voi tehdä itsepalveluostoja, mutta he voivat hankkia maksuttomia kokeiluversioita tuotteille, jotka eivät vaadi maksutavan lisäämistä. Kokeilujakson päätyttyä käyttäjä ei voi ostaa tuotteen maksullista versiota. |
Poistettu käytöstä | Käyttäjät eivät voi tehdä itsepalveluostoja tai hankkia kokeiluversioita tuotteelle. |
Saat tietyn tuotteen käytäntöasetuksen suorittamalla seuraavan komennon:
Get-MSCommerceProductPolicy -PolicyId AllowSelfServicePurchase -ProductId CFQ7TTC0KP0N
Jos haluat ottaa käytäntöasetuksen käyttöön tietylle tuotteelle, suorita seuraava komento:
Update-MSCommerceProductPolicy -PolicyId AllowSelfServicePurchase -ProductId CFQ7TTC0KP0N -Value "Enabled"
Jos haluat poistaa käytöstä tietyn tuotteen käytäntöasetuksen, suorita seuraava komento:
Update-MSCommerceProductPolicy -PolicyId AllowSelfServicePurchase -ProductId CFQ7TTC0KP0N -Value "Disabled"
Jos haluat sallia käyttäjien kokeilla tiettyä tuotetta ilman maksutapaa, suorita seuraava komento:
Update-MSCommerceProductPolicy -PolicyId AllowSelfServicePurchase -ProductId CFQ7TTC0KP0N -Value "OnlyTrialsWithoutPaymentMethod"
Saat tietyn kolmannen osapuolen tarjoustyypin käytäntöasetuksen suorittamalla seuraavan komennon:
Get-MSCommerceProductPolicy -PolicyId AllowSelfServicePurchase -OfferType <ID>
Jos haluat ottaa käytäntöasetuksen käyttöön tietylle kolmannen osapuolen tarjoustyypille, suorita seuraava komento:
Update-MSCommerceProductPolicy -PolicyId AllowSelfServicePurchase -OfferType <ID> -Value "Enabled"
Jos haluat poistaa käytöstä tietyn kolmannen osapuolen tarjoustyypin käytäntöasetuksen, suorita seuraava komento:
Update-MSCommerceProductPolicy -PolicyId AllowSelfServicePurchase -OfferType <ID> -Value "Disabled"
Esimerkkikomentosarja, joka poistaa AllowSelfServicePurchase-toiminnon käytöstä
Seuraavassa esimerkissä kerrotaan, miten voit tuoda MSCommerce-moduulin , kirjautua sisään tililläsi, hankkia Käyttäjäkohtaisen Power Automaten ProductId-tunnuksen ja poistaa sitten käytöstä allowSelfServicePurchase-toiminnon kyseiselle tuotteelle.
Import-Module -Name MSCommerce
Connect-MSCommerce #sign-in with your global or billing administrator account when prompted
$product = Get-MSCommerceProductPolicies -PolicyId AllowSelfServicePurchase | where {$_.ProductName -match 'Power Automate per user'}
Update-MSCommerceProductPolicy -PolicyId AllowSelfServicePurchase -ProductId $product.ProductID -Value "Disabled"
Jos tuotteelle on useita arvoja, voit suorittaa komennon yksitellen kullekin arvolle seuraavassa esimerkissä esitetyllä tavalla:
Update-MSCommerceProductPolicy -PolicyId AllowSelfServicePurchase -ProductId $product[0].ProductID -Value "Disabled"
Update-MSCommerceProductPolicy -PolicyId AllowSelfServicePurchase -ProductId $product[1].ProductID -Value "Disabled"
Update-MSCommerceProductPolicy -PolicyId AllowSelfServicePurchase -OfferType SaaS -Value "Disabled"
Vianmääritys
Ongelma
Näyttöön tulee seuraava virhesanoma:
HandleError: Käytännön noutaminen epäonnistui: PolicyId 'AllowSelfServicePurchase', ErrorMessage – Pohjana oleva yhteys suljettiin: Lähetystoiminnossa ilmeni odottamaton virhe.
Tämä saattaa johtua TLS:n vanhemmasta versiosta. Kun muodostat yhteyden tähän palveluun, sinun on käytettävä TLS 1.2:ta tai uudempaa
Ratkaisu
Päivitä TLS 1.2:een. Seuraava syntaksi päivittää ServicePointManager-suojausprotokollan sallimaan TLS1.2:n:
[Net.ServicePointManager]::SecurityProtocol = [Net.ServicePointManager]::SecurityProtocol -bor [Net.SecurityProtocolType]::Tls12
Lisätietoja on artikkelissa TLS 1.2:n käyttöönotto.
Aiheeseen liittyvä sisältö
Itsepalveluostojen hallinta (Hallinta) (artikkeli)
Omatoimisen oston usein kysytyt kysymykset (artikkeli)
Palaute
https://aka.ms/ContentUserFeedback.
Tulossa pian: Vuoden 2024 aikana poistamme asteittain GitHub Issuesin käytöstä sisällön palautemekanismina ja korvaamme sen uudella palautejärjestelmällä. Lisätietoja on täällä:Lähetä ja näytä palaute kohteelle